Bolasie excited about Prem chance

Crystal Palace winger Yannick Bolasie says he is ready to prove himself as a Premier League player.

Bolasie made his top flight debut at Liverpool last weekend after missing the start of the campaign with a hamstring injury.

The Londoner impressed when he came off the bench in the second half at Anfield and says he has been using his time on the sidelines to study opposing defenders.

"I've been watching every team I can, looking at their full-backs; what they're good at and what they don't like," he said.

"I get to see how my opponents play and what their weaknesses are. Before this season I'd never seen a Premier League match live so it's been a buzz.

"The matches look tough, the teams keep the ball a bit better but for myself as a winger it looks like you have a chance to run at players.

"In the Championship you've probably got two or three players on you but in the Premier League everyone can do their own job so it's one on one.

I'm very confident I can do well.

"I was expecting to play in the opening match against Tottenham but I got injured on the Tuesday before the weekend.

"I was really gutted because I wanted to be there for my team and obviously it was the start of the Premier League so I was even more gutted. I'm glad I'm finally seeing a bit of light at the end of the tunnel now."
